We use this vinyl window graphic at work to improve the look of our store front. I called our print shop and asked for some scrap and they sent me some. I spray painted it black and then wiped it with a damp cloth to get the effect to help break up patterns. Here is the view from the outside of my stand. And from the inside. I have no more than 75 yards either direction, so binoculars make it easy to see through. Thoughts?

It isn't ideal, but there are a couple of ways to overcome that. First I always use binoculars. They tend to make it easier to see through the window. You can also slide the window open slighty. Understand I am on a wooded trail that is extremely dense. I wouldn't need or want this if I had more than 100 yards to glass.
